Key Responsibilities

  • Evaluate and treat patients with mobility, strength, balance, and functional impairments
  • Create and implement personalized care plans
  • Collaborate with team members to ensure quality outcomes
  • Maintain documentation to meet all regulatory requirements
  • Ensure all required physician orders are obtained and up to date

Requirements:

  • Degree from an APTA-accredited Physical Therapy program (BS, MS, or DPT)
  • Current license as a Physical Therapist in the state of practice
  • Strong communication and organizational skills
